Kazuki Matsunaga has authored 20 papers that have received a total of 362 indexed citations.
This includes 10 papers in Physiology, 9 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and 8 papers in Molecular Biology. The topics of these papers are Nitric Oxide and Endothelin Effects (8 papers),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(7 papers) and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(5 papers). Kazuki Matsunaga is often cited by papers focused on Nitric Oxide and Endothelin Effects (8 papers),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(7 papers) and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(5 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Japan and United States. Kazuki Matsunaga's co-authors include Motohiko Ueda, Takanori Iwasaki, Hisayuki Matsuo, Kazuo Kitamura and Robert F. Furchgott and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Pharmacology and Experimental Therapeutics, Neuroscience Letters and Biochimie.
